Review and Prospect on Low Power Electric Propulsion for Micro-satellites

  • With the continuous expansion of micro-satellite missions, there is an increasing demand for low power propulsion systems in orbit maneuvering, position holding, attitude control, autonomous deorbiting and other missions. Combined with the technical requirements of micro-satellite for high specific impulse, precise thrust and compact structure of low power propulsion systems, the research and application status of RF propulsion, pulsed plasma electric propulsion and other propulsion systems were summarized. By listing application cases from various countries, the performance and technical characteristics of each propulsion system were compared and the key technologies of each propulsion system were summarized. The development trend and subsequent key issues of electric propulsion technology for micro-satellites in china were analyzed and the research results can provide a reference for the scheme selection of the propulsion system of micro-satellites..
